<h3 style="text-align:left;">Nottingham Forest’s Revolutionary Strategy</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">Nottingham Forest&#8217;s approach to their Premier League promotion is noteworthy, as they opted for an entirely new squad upon their ascent. When they secured their spot in the Premier League, their management decided to invest heavily in player transfers, bringing in a host of fresh talent to bolster their ranks. This strategy, while high-risk, ultimately proved successful. Their investments included a mix of seasoned professionals and promising talents, allowing the team to adapt quickly to the demands of the Premier League. Furthermore, the decision to move on from long-time manager <strong>Steve Cooper</strong> in favor of <strong>Nuno Espirito Santo</strong> demonstrated a willingness to innovate and take bold steps to secure their place in the league. This kind of strategic gamble paid off, as Forest made several key signings, generating revenue by selling players like <strong>Brennan Johnson</strong> and acquiring new stars such as <strong>Anthony Elanga</strong> and <strong>Callum Hudson-Odoi</strong>.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">Brentford&#8217;s Steady Approach</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">In contrast to Nottingham Forest, Brentford adopted a more measured approach to their Premier League experience. Under the guidance of manager <strong>Thomas Frank</strong>, they built a cohesive unit focused on solidifying a competitive identity without relying heavily on star players. Their success was driven largely by effective recruitment strategies and a commitment to fostering a collective team spirit. Players like <strong>Bryan Mbeumo</strong> and <strong>Yoane Wissa</strong> emerged as vital contributors to the team&#8217;s success, showcasing the effectiveness of teamwork over individual brilliance. Despite facing challenges, including the suspension and eventual sale of their star striker <strong>Ivan Toney</strong>, Brentford managed to adapt and retain their position in the Premier League. This illustrates that a balanced and well-structured approach can yield success even without marquee names.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">The Path to Premier League Survival</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">Survival in the Premier League is notoriously challenging, especially for teams coming from the Championship. Historical data emphasizes that newly promoted teams often struggle to maintain their status. In fact, only four teams have achieved this since 2014, indicating the fierce competition they face. The average finishing position for playoff winners in their first season back is a worrying 17.6, a precarious situation for any club hoping to avoid relegation. However, there are paths to success; learning from the resilience shown by teams like Brentford and Nottingham Forest provides valuable insights into crafting a strategy that can lead to sustainable success. With smart recruitment and effective management, the winning team from the playoff can work towards securing a strong footing in the Premier League.</p>

<h3 style="text-align:left;">The Rise of Xabi Alonso</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">The journey of <strong>Xabi Alonso</strong> from a celebrated player to a promising manager has captured the attention of the footballing world. After a successful playing career that saw him win major trophies with clubs like Real Madrid and Liverpool, his managerial stint at Bayer Leverkusen solidified his reputation. During his tenure, he transformed the team into a formidable force, demonstrating an ability to develop talent and implement tactical innovations. With the imminent vacancy at Real Madrid, Alonso&#8217;s name has emerged as a leading candidate to take the helm, offering fans and players alike hope for a new era marked by progressive football.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">Potential Impact on Arda Guler</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">Among the many players under Real Madrid&#8217;s umbrella, <strong>Arda Guler</strong> stands out as a young talent with immense potential. Signed in the summer of 2023, Guler has shown flashes of brilliance but has struggled to secure a regular spot in the starting eleven. Ancelotti&#8217;s departure presents a unique opportunity for Guler; Alonso&#8217;s coaching philosophy, which emphasizes the development of young players, could serve as a catalyst for the Turkish midfielder&#8217;s growth. Alonso&#8217;s previous success with young talents at Leverkusen, such as <strong>Florian Wirtz</strong>, offers an optimistic outlook for Guler&#8217;s tenure at Madrid, as he may finally find the consistent playing time and role he needs to flourish.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">Trent Alexander-Arnold: A Potential Signing</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">As Real Madrid gears up for the new season, there is growing speculation about potential signings that could redefine the squad. <strong>Trent Alexander-Arnold</strong>, a dynamic full-back currently at Liverpool, has hinted at leaving the club at the end of his contract. Alonso’s previous success utilizing full-backs as key components of his tactical framework at Bayer Leverkusen raises questions about Alexander-Arnold’s fit within his envisioned system. The young Englishman’s experience could prove invaluable, potentially transforming him into a linchpin of the new lineup as Madrid embarks on a formidable competitive campaign.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">Optimizing Jude Bellingham&#8217;s Talents</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">Another player who could see significant changes under Alonso is <strong>Jude Bellingham</strong>. Currently one of Real Madrid&#8217;s standout performers, Bellingham has shown the versatility to operate in various midfield roles. However, with a shift in managerial philosophy, he may find himself playing a more advanced position, potentially mirroring the role that <strong>Florian Wirtz</strong> played under Alonso. By leveraging Bellingham&#8217;s skills to optimize his contributions in attack, Alonso could enhance the player’s influence on matches, offering him the platform to elevate his performance to new heights in the coming season.</p>

<h3 style="text-align:left;">Stellar Performances: Rising Stars and Veteran Resurgence</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">As the NHL enters its critical phase, individual performances are drawing attention. <strong>Wyatt Johnston</strong>, only 21 years old, has made headlines with his recent signing of a five-year, $42 million contract extension with the Dallas Stars. This decision signals the strength of the team’s management, led by General Manager <strong>Jim Nill</strong>, especially considering Johnston&#8217;s impressive 60 points this season, making him third on the team. His cap hit of $8.5 million is already deemed a bargain as he continues to demonstrate exponential growth on ice.</p>
<p style="text-align:left;">On the other hand, <strong>John Carlson</strong> of the Washington Capitals is experiencing a career renaissance. Carlson has been a driving force behind the blue line, accumulating 42 points while maintaining a commendable plus-14 goal differential at 5-on-5 situations. This resurgence comes at a pivotal moment, as the Capitals aim for a strong finish in the playoff race. Carlson&#8217;s 55.0% expected goals share exemplifies his return to form as a top defenseman, playing a crucial role in the team’s quest for postseason glory.</p>
<h3 style="text-align:left;">Navigating Injury Challenges</h3>
<p style="text-align:left;">Injuries have significantly influenced the performance and strategy of numerous teams this season. The Florida Panthers, for instance, are primarily focused on making the playoffs while dealing with key injuries. Star player <strong>Matthew Tkachuk</strong> is sidelined due to an injury sustained during the 4 Nations Face-Off, exacerbating the current challenges faced by the team while also introducing new dynamics as they integrate recently acquired players like <strong>Brad Marchand</strong>.</p>
<p style="text-align:left;">The team&#8217;s management is faced with difficult decisions, such as coping with the 20-game suspension of top-four defenseman <strong>Aaron Ekblad</strong> due to performance-enhancing drug use. Despite these challenges, the reigning champions have managed to stay competitive, recently winning six consecutive games. Such resilience will prove essential as they approach the final stretch of the season.</p>
